      AEK Athens, the reigning champion of the Super League Greece, holds an advantage in terms of the team's total market value. Their home stadium always creates an electrifying atmosphere. In the first round of the new - season league, they achieved a resounding 4 - 0 victory at home, indicating a revival of their offensive form. In the first leg, they played to a goalless draw away from home. This shows that there's still room for improvement in their ability to break down the opponent's defense. Fortunately, the team's main lineup remains largely intact, and most of their key attacking players are available for selection. Playing at home this time, AEK Athens needs to be proactive in seeking goals and strive to secure qualification for the next stage.

      Looking back at the previous encounter between the two teams, when Sofia Levski hosted Athens, the game ended in a 0 - 0 draw. The corner - kick count was 1 - 2 in favor of Athens, indicating that the away team had a clear edge in this aspect. This historical data reflects the balance of both teams' offensive and defensive systems. Sofia Levski, despite failing to score at home, managed a clean sheet, which shows the stability of their overall defense. On the other hand, Athens demonstrated remarkable ability to create offensive opportunities from corner - kicks during the away game. The difference in corner - kick numbers suggests that their wing - based offensive organization was more threatening. Now, Athens has the home - field advantage. They face the challenge of breaking the dead - lock pattern that occurred in the away game.
